Patch 1.1.1 for Anthem is live. The patch contains a number of fixes and quality-of-life improvements, as well as a significant gameplay change.

As of this patch, BioWare is removing Elysian Caches from Anthem. These reward crates were originally added to the game back in March. The crates provided players with rewards for completing Strongholds and keeping up to date with daily challenges. Elysian Caches contained cosmetic items and crafting materials, but never armor or weapons. BioWare says Elysian Caches have "always been planned as a temporary thing". The studio isn't ruling out bringing the reward chests back, but they're gone as of yesterday's update. Unfortunately, that means you won't be able to use any remaining Elysian Keys you've acquired.

Here's the rest of the changelog for Anthem patch 1.1.1:

  • Fixed an error where Weapon and Components stat values were not displaying correctly.

  • Fixed a problem where suit power level (rarity) was not correctly being calculated based on equipped items.

  • Fixed an issue with Spanish audio in a conversation in the Sunken Cell stronghold.

  • Fixed an issue with French audio in a conversation in the Sunken Cell stronghold.

  • Fixed an issue causing a slight delay in Salvaging at End of Expedition

  • Partially defeated encounters will no longer re-dispense loot from previously defeated creatures.

  • [PC ONLY] – Right-clicking an item to salvage it at the end of expedition screen now requires the mouse button to be held.

It's not a massively substantial patch excepting the removal of Elysian Caches. The far more significant Patch 1.1.0 dropped back in April, bringing with it a new Stronghold in the form of The Sunken Cell. That patch also brought news that BioWare would be delaying certain Act 1 Calendar features indefinitely. We'll let you know if Elysian Caches make a return to Anthem.
